-- Ken in Atlanta At 03:38 PM 3/16/2008, Mike Wickham wrote: > > Microsoft word has the capability to print out the characteristics of > > Styles contained within the document. How would one do the same for > > Paragraph Designs in Frame? > >Format List, part of the Systec Toolbox, does a very nice job. It creates a >table of all the styles and nearly all their characteristics. You can find >it here: > >https://www.systec-gmbh.com/os/index.php?cat=c12_Windows.html&XTCsid=afec57784912ef717a8b43a91b8993b9 > >Paragraph Tools from http://www.siliconprairiesoftware.com/Products.html can >also produce a list. This tool is less expensive, and _well_ worth having >for its many other features, but its list of formats is simply that-- a >list. It produces a list, for each style, of all characteristics. It's very >useful if you're looking at a particular style, but I like the Systec Format >List plugin a lot more for this task. It puts all the styles in a nice >table.
